Don't sweat going over the dam because it's now the only way into the River Pond Park! Plus Senor is right, it doesn't add but a minute or two to your travel time.
If you really want to save time and are coming from the SW part of the state be sure to do the following.
When you come into Manhattan on K-18, be sure to exit north on Highway K-113 (also known as Seth Child Road). It is a main highway that runs north & south on the west side of town, thus avoiding a bunch of stop lights and commercial traffic near the mall, restaurants, downtown, etc.
If you take Seth Child Road north, stay on it until you come to a tee intersection on the north side of town @ Highway 24. When you come to that Tee intersection, turn RIGHT (east) and go towards Tuttle Creek Reservoir. Your next turn will be left onto Highway K-13 which goes over the dam. After you've crossed the day, your next turn will be a right turn onto River Pond Road. Just follow river pond road until you black see disc golf baskets.
For those of you that are really familiar with the area, DO NOT TAKE "THE BACK WAY"! They are redoing a bridge on the Barnes Road / Dyer Road route that goes over the Big Blue River
